Still haven't made anything new in months...Sigh. But anyway...here is another piece I made with a textured copper backplate, brass for the 'splash', a copper fish head I formed with my hydraulic press using a steel die that is reproduction of an antique and a flush set CZ. Dat fishy is hungry!

I am trying to psych myself up to get back into the studio and make some new things by posting stuff I made in the last year or so. This is a copper trinket dish. The center is a copper piece I formed (using a reproduction steel die) with my hydraulic press, then sawed it out and soldered in.

When I'm not feeling horrified by the state of our political dumbfuckery at the present time...I make things. These earrings are made with copper elements I die struck using a hydraulic press and soldered. The cabochon is blue Paua shell. I call them 'Blue Moon Fox in the Hedgerow'.
